RT @gregisenberg: what if you could turn two hours of AI work into a week of viral content that gets 2M+ impressions/week?
every morning, dan koe opens chatgpt/claude and uses them like an internal strategy team and it's paid off through millions of new followers and $$.
he feeds them top-performing posts and asks for the hidden patterns like structure, rhythm, curiosity gaps, emotional payoff.
from there, he builds a repeatable system that turns 2 hours of work into 7 days of content.
his playbook looks like this:
1. validate fast
start on twitter. write two or three high-density posts a day. when one hits, that’s your signal. expand it into a newsletter, then a youtube script, then repurpose across linkedin, instagram, threads, and shorts.
2. one source drives all
one weekly newsletter becomes the foundation. one youtube video per week comes straight from that outline. the goal is not more ideas—it’s one good idea multiplied.
3. compress research with AI
he drops long-form videos into claude or chatgpt and gets six hours of research condensed into a thousand words. he compares it with his own archives to find fresh angles.
4. the prompt stack
after writing, he runs everything through a custom set of prompts:
– a youtube title generator trained on his top 15 titles to create 30 new ones
– a deep post generator that extracts paradoxes, transformation arcs, and action steps
– a content idea generator that outputs 60 tweet ideas across proven formats
5. structure swapping
he keeps a swipe file of viral posts and tests their structures on new ideas turning one seed into multiple posts.
6. growth loop
when a post type drives followers, he doubles down for a few weeks, then moves to the next format. the algorithm shifts, but his system adapts.

Veo3 fast on the Gemini app
{
"subject": {
"verbatim": "Alien tropical coastline at night with palm islets, tessellated ocean surface, and a giant geodesic ringed moon in the sky."
},
"shot": {
"type": "establishing wide",
"framing": "low shoreline vantage, camera ~0.6 m above wet tessellated water, islets and palms centered mid-distance",
"lens": "24mm spherical, shallow distortion kept natural",
"motion": "slow push-in (dolly forward) from shore toward islets; no secondary moves"
},
"scene": {
"environment": "calm surf over triangular mosaic tiles that shimmer faint gold; black lava rocks; sparse palms on tiny islets; misty blue mountains far background; starry sky with a pale sun on horizon and a massive translucent geodesic ringed moon overhead",
"time_of_day": "blue hour / night",
"weather": "clear, slight haze over water, gentle onshore breeze"
},
"visual_details": {
"beats": [
{
"time": "0.0s–2.7s",
"action": "Waves lap over the tessellated shore; golden lines glint as foam recedes; foreground rocks pass frame edges creating parallax.",
"focus": "texture of wet tiles and foam micro-ripples"
},
{
"time": "2.7s–5.4s",
"action": "Push-in reveals palm islets; moonlight back-rim on palm fronds; distant mountains emerge through haze.",
"focus": "silhouetted palms against misty ridgelines"
},
{
"time": "5.4s–8.0s",
"action": "Geodesic ringed moon dominates upper frame; gold lattice reflections ripple across water; final hold for 0.5s for a clean endpoint.",
"focus": "celestial dome and shimmering water grid"
}
]
},
"cinematography": {
"lighting": "soft moonlight key from horizon left; cool cyan fill from sky; specular highlights along tile edges; no harsh flares",
"exposure": "ETTR but protect highlights on water; gentle roll-off",
"grade": "retro-futurist teal/cyan with subtle golden accents; light halation on bright edges; fine film-grain 10%"
},
"audio": {
"ambience": "gentle ocean surf, distant wind through palms",
"music": "low analog synth pad, single evolving chord; soft glassy chime swell at 5.5s",
"dialogue": null
},
"color_palette": {
"primary": ["#0B3C5D", "#0E6BA8", "#6FB1FC"],
"accents": ["#E9D27D", "#96D1C7"],
"notes": "cool nocturne blues with restrained gold lattice glints"
},
"physics_rules": [
"Wave period ~4–6 s; foam breaks on rocks with small splashes and natural decay.",
"Palm fronds sway 3–5° with wind; motion lags trunk by ~200 ms.",
"Wet tiles show moving speculars that track camera push; reflections obey surface normals.",
"Atmospheric perspective increases with distance (reduced contrast, slight cyan shift)."
],
"visual_rules": [
"One primary camera motion only (slow push-in).",
"No text, subtitles, logos, or UI of any kind.",
"No people, boats, or buildings.",
"Keep stars steady (no star trails); avoid lens flares/bokeh bursts.",
"End on a stable composition for seamless cut/loop."
]
}
